Abstract:
The present invention relates to a method for selectively amplifying non-methylated sequences of a DNA comprising the steps of (i) providing a sample comprising a DNA which is methylated at least one site, (ii) treating the DNA in the sample with a methylation-dependent nuclease, and (iii) amplifying the DNA cut using the methylation-dependent nuclease. In addition, the invention relates to kits for use in the method according to the invention. The method according to the invention can be used for selectively preparing to (selectively accumulating) non-methylated sequence segments of genomic DNA and for analysing the global methylation pattern in genomic DNA.
